Job summary

Belton Regional Medical Center in Belton, MO is seeking a Radiology Technologist to operate standard, portable, and specialized X-ray equipment to perform radiographic exams for diagnosis and treatment. This role emphasizes patient care, safety, and teamwork in a busy clinical setting.

You will prepare patients, develop and process films, administer contrast when needed, transfer images to PACS, and maintain aseptic technique and room readiness between patients.

Qualifications

  • BLS must be obtained within 30 days of start date.
  • ARRT-R Radiography must be obtained within 6 months of start date.
  • Certificate required.

Responsibilities

  • Prepare patients for radiological procedures and take x-rays following established procedures for patient care and safety.
  • Develop and process films and transmit to a Radiologist for interpretation.
  • Administer contrast media and medications within the accepted scope of practice and applicable state and federal regulations.
  • Ensure prompt transfer of images and documents to PACS system (image quality, correct lead markers and patient data/history).
  • Turn over and prepare room using aseptic technique between patients and clean/sterilize equipment.
  • Follow radiation safety procedures and guidelines.

Belton Regional Medical Center is an 80+ bed acute care facility. We are located in Belton and serve southern Jackson and northern Cass counties. We are one of 10 HCA Healthcare Midwest Health System hospitals in Kansas City. We offer a full range of inpatient and outpatient services. Our services are supported by our excellent colleagues, advanced technology, and deep relationships within the community. Over the past decade, our hospital underwent a $39.2 million dollar renovation and expansion project. This project has enabled us to meet the growing medical needs of our community. Our hospital is equipped with a beautiful memorial garden, patient advocates, and private rooms. We are recognized by The Joint Commission, American College of Radiology, and College of American Pathologists Laboratory Accreditation Program.
